Big home win

Body

Redlands Community College women’s soccer team closed out the regular season with a 2-0 win over Northeastern Oklahoma A&M at Memorial Stadium.

The Cougars made the NJCAA Region 2 Championships for the first time since 2018 and play Thursday (10/30) in Enid.

Prayers for healing, hope

Body

A 25-year-old El Reno man was taken into custody last week after police said he was responsible for the incident that put a veteran officer in an Oklahoma City hospital where he is listed in critical condition. 

A prayer vigil was held Sunday evening in downtown El Reno for Sgt. Thomas Duran, a 14-year veteran of the department.

Duran is reported to be in the Intensive Care Unit at OU Medical Center.

Council OKs zoning swap, hears ‘Hub’ site updates

Body

The El Reno City Council approved a zoning change for property at 16399 W. Highway 66 where it’s expected a landscape design business plans to locate. 

Site One Landscape Supply requested the zoning change from Rural Agricultural District (A-1) to Moderate Industrial District (I-2) and Commercial Office District (CO). Council unanimously approved the request. 

A representative for the company said Site One Landscape Supply has operations in several states. He applauded the City of El Reno as being one of the more business-friendly towns the firm has worked with.

Local business earns REI honors

Body

Red Tulip Designs is a female and veteran-owned business based in EI Reno.

The firm was named the REI Business Lending Direct Borrow of the Year at a recent event celebrating businesses supported by REI, an economic development program that supports Oklahoma businesses.
